In order to accomplish success in your working life you need to take excellent care of yourself.

If you are keen to take the steps towards preventing stress at work in order to avoid burnout, then it is essential to pencil in the time for hobbies that make you feel your most relaxed. Many individuals wind up getting so wrapped up in their day-to-day obligations that they forget simply how vital it is to take some time out to completely relax. Among the best choices to think about if this applies to you would certainly be reading books whenever you get the chance. Many individuals do not understand that staring at screens and utilising technology every day can in fact have great deals of negative impacts on the mind, including increasing feelings of tension and anxiousness. By stepping away from technology for a while and losing yourself in a book, you are giving your brain a chance to disconnect from the continuous activity of various devices. When looking at how to prevent burnout in the workplace, one of the key things to emphasise is the importance of taking breaks. Many people wind up feeling stressed out because they are continuously busy, forgetting to make the time to take a breather and take care of themselves along the way. If you have actually been experiencing some burnout symptoms such as tiredness or a lack of motivation, then a crucial idea would be to begin practicing mindfulness throughout the working day. Taking just a few moments away from your computer screen and doing a brief meditation can entirely shift your frame of mind and allow you to gain a new perspective. It is so important that you check in with yourself when you feel your tension levels building up, taking some deep breaths and letting your mind unwind for a moment. For anyone who has actually been working exceptionally hard and neglecting to make the time for breaks, you might be in a position where you are wondering how to recover from burnout. In this case, one of the essential ideas is to practice self-compassion instead of pushing yourself further. When you are feeling exhausted and stressed, you really need to prioritise your psychological wellbeing and do things in your spare time that make you feel relaxed and calm. This regularly will mean staying in and getting a good night's sleep, permitting your mind and body to get some rest instead of constantly being on the go.
